How do you measure a roll of paper towels?

To measure a roll of paper towels, you can determine its width, length, and diameter. The width is the distance across the roll, while the diameter is the measurement from one side of the roll to the other through the center. To find the length of the paper, you can multiply the number of sheets by the length of a single sheet. Additionally, checking the number of sheets per roll can help assess the total amount of paper available.

What is the length and width if the perimeter is 352 and the length is 10 times the width?

Length Plus width = half of perimeter = 176. Width is one-eleventh of this and length is ten-elevenths ie 16 and 160 respectively.
